we're continuing to see clear examples where a model's harness is a major determinant of overall performance. with the same model, running on same task, it's easy to observe very different scores depending on (system) prompts, tools (& their descriptions), and middleware (steering hooks). this is exactly why we built a harness profiles abstraction in Deep Agents: per-provider or per-model overrides for base system prompts, tool names + implementations, etc., so swapping models doesn't mean losing the work that made the last one good! 10–20pt jumps on tau2-bench in our own testing. currently cooking up built-in profiles for popular open weight models 🧑🍳 https://www.langchain.com/blog/tuning-deep-agents-different-models you've heard that models are highly trained in their harnesses, but... it appears that pi is about 7-10% better than codex with gpt-5.4 on a ProgramBench task. Same exact prompt, same environment. It's a good harness.
